Summary of Role: 

As a SMTS for Systems Architect, Analog ASSP, you will serve as the technical leader and chief architect for strategic Analog ASSP product families. You will define long-term product and technology strategy, drive system architecture decisions across multiple product generations, and lead cross-functional engineering teams in developing differentiated semiconductor solutions.

This role requires deep expertise in analog and mixed-signal system architecture, strong customer and market engagement, and the ability to influence technical direction across business units, development sites, and external ecosystems. You will act as a recognized authority within the company, shaping product roadmaps and advancing GF's Analog ASSP portfolio through technical innovation and thought leadership.

Essential Responsibilities:

  • Define and drive long-term product and technology roadmaps for Analog ASSP solutions.

  • Lead system architecture development for PMICs, motor drivers, protection and batteries management.

  • Own system-level tradeoffs across performance, power, cost, reliability, manufacturability, and functional safety.

  • Lead cross-functional teams across design, validation, product engineering, manufacturing, and applications.

  • Drive product differentiation through innovation, competitive benchmarking, and technology assessments.

  • Act as senior technical interface for strategic customers and partners.

  • Mentor engineers and influence technical direction across sites and organizations.

What We Do

GlobalFoundries (GF) is one of the world’s leading semiconductor manufacturers. GF is redefining innovation and semiconductor manufacturing by developing and delivering feature-rich process technology solutions that provide leadership performance in pervasive high growth markets. GF offers a unique mix of design, development, and fabrication services. With a talented and diverse workforce and an at-scale manufacturing footprint spanning the U.S., Europe and Asia, GF is a trusted technology source to its worldwide customers.
